In the rapidly evolving world of cryptocurrencies, Bitcoin remains the most popular digital currency. As the demand for Bitcoin grows, so does the need for reliable and secure Bitcoin wallets. With numerous options available, choosing the right Bitcoin wallet can be a daunting task. This article aims to provide a comprehensive guide to help you select the best Bitcoin wallet that suits your needs.
Firstly, it's essential to understand the different types of Bitcoin wallets. There are primarily four types: software wallets, hardware wallets, paper wallets, and web wallets. Each type has its own set of advantages and disadvantages, and the choice depends on your specific requirements.
1. Software Wallets
Software wallets are applications that you can download and install on your computer or mobile device. They are easy to use and provide access to your Bitcoin balance at any time. However, they are also more susceptible to hacking and loss. Some popular software wallets include:
- **Which Bitcoin Wallet**: Electrum
Electrum is a lightweight and popular software wallet that offers fast transactions and a simple user interface. It supports both Bitcoin and Bitcoin Cash and is available for Windows, macOS, and Linux.
- **Which Bitcoin Wallet**: Bitcoin Core
Bitcoin Core is the official Bitcoin client and wallet, developed by the Bitcoin community. It is a full node wallet that verifies all Bitcoin transactions on the network, ensuring security and decentralization.
2. Hardware Wallets
Hardware wallets are physical devices designed to store your Bitcoin and other cryptocurrencies offline, providing enhanced security. They are considered the safest option for storing large amounts of Bitcoin. Some popular hardware wallets include:
- **Which Bitcoin Wallet**: Ledger Nano S
The Ledger Nano S is a highly secure hardware wallet that supports over 1,200 cryptocurrencies. It offers a simple and user-friendly interface and is compatible with both Windows and macOS.
- **Which Bitcoin Wallet**: Trezor Model T
Trezor Model T is another popular hardware wallet known for its advanced security features. It features a color touchscreen and supports over 1,000 cryptocurrencies. It is compatible with Windows, macOS, and Linux.
3. Paper Wallets
Paper wallets are essentially a piece of paper containing your Bitcoin private and public keys. They are considered one of the most secure ways to store Bitcoin, as they are not connected to the internet. However, they can be easily damaged or lost. Paper wallets are best suited for long-term storage of Bitcoin.
4. Web Wallets
Web wallets are online services that allow you to access your Bitcoin balance and make transactions through a web browser. They are convenient but come with the risk of being hacked or compromised. Some popular web wallets include:
- **Which Bitcoin Wallet**: Blockchain.com
Blockchain.com is a well-known web wallet that offers a simple and user-friendly interface. It supports Bitcoin, Bitcoin Cash, and Ethereum, and allows users to buy, sell, and trade cryptocurrencies.
- **Which Bitcoin Wallet**: Coinbase Wallet
Coinbase Wallet is a secure and easy-to-use web wallet offered by the popular cryptocurrency exchange Coinbase. It supports Bitcoin, Ethereum, and ERC-20 tokens, and allows users to store, send, and receive cryptocurrencies.
In conclusion, the best Bitcoin wallet for you will depend on your individual needs and preferences. If you are looking for a simple and easy-to-use wallet, a software wallet like Electrum or Bitcoin Core might be the right choice. For enhanced security, a hardware wallet like Ledger Nano S or Trezor Model T would be more suitable. If you prefer the convenience of an online wallet, Blockchain.com or Coinbase Wallet could be your best option. Remember to research and compare the features and security measures of each wallet before making your decision.
